What M92 hardware batches (variations or revisions) are out there?

Does anybody have any sort of information in this sense.
A while ago I read around here that some of the more recently shipped ereaders has small variations in terms of hardware although the general functionality will remain the same

What do you guys know about this?

Can't tell you exactly how many are out there, but I got my white M92 in January (?) 2012, while my girlfriend got black version around January this year.

The biggest hardware difference I noticed was the little joystick on the right: while mine can be moved in 8 directions (N, E, S, W, NE, SE, SW, NW), hers only moves in 4 (N, E, S, W). Also the new stick feels more solid and has better haptics.
